Amiad Filtration Systems”Amiad Automatic Microfiber (AMF) filtration system received approvalfor use as a filtration technology for achieving the required turbiditylevel under the California Water Recycling Criteria, also known asTitle 22. The company’s 20-micron system received the state’s officialapproval; the AMF system is also available for 10, seven, three andtwo-micron levels of filtration.The system is designed to capture sediment in microfibers tightly woundaround plastic cartridges, and then automatically clean itself with ahigh-velocity stream of water deflected off the plastic cartridges.TheTitle 22 approval identifies the Amiad AMF as a complement to anapproved disinfection process.  Disinfection technologies approvedunder the Recycling Criteria include chlorine, UV or ozone.
